The ARC AI signal feed is powerful โ€” but not every signal is relevant to every user. An NFT trader doesn't need whale alerts on DeFi tokens. A long-term investor doesn't need launch radar noise. Elite users can tune the feed to show only what they care about.

Where to find Agent Config

Navigate to Dashboard โ†’ Agent Config. This page is exclusive to Elite plan users. It has three sections: confidence threshold, tag filters, and agent toggles.

Confidence threshold

Every signal ARC AI generates has a confidence score โ€” how certain the detecting agent is that the signal is genuine. The default is 0%, meaning all signals pass through regardless of confidence.

Raising this threshold filters out low-confidence noise. For example:

  • 0%: See everything, including early weak signals.
  • 50%: See signals where the agent has at least moderate conviction. Good default for most traders.
  • 75%: High-conviction signals only. Much lower volume but very high signal-to-noise ratio.

If your feed feels noisy, try setting the threshold to 50% first. If it is too quiet, bring it back down.

Tag muting

ARC AI signals are tagged with one of six categories. You can mute any tag entirely:

  • ๐Ÿ‹ Whale: Large wallet movements โ€” accumulation, distribution, or transfer events.
  • ๐Ÿš€ Launch: New token launches detected by Sentinel.
  • โšก Momentum: Tokens showing unusual price or volume acceleration.
  • ๐Ÿค– Narrative: Macro and sector-level trend signals from the Nexus agent.
  • ๐Ÿ”” Alert: Urgent signals โ€” potential rugpulls in progress, sudden liquidity removals.
  • โš ๏ธ Scam: High-confidence scam detections from Sentinel.

Muted tags are applied server-side โ€” they do not just hide content from the UI, they reduce the data sent to your session entirely.

Agent toggles

Each of ARC AI's four agents can be toggled on or off independently:

  • Nexus: Macro narrative and sentiment analysis. Disable if you only trade technical setups and find narrative signals irrelevant.
  • Momentum: Price and volume acceleration detection. Disable if you are a contrarian trader or focus on fundamentals only.
  • Hunter: New opportunity and launch detection. Disable if you do not trade new tokens.
  • Sentinel: Risk and scam detection. We recommend keeping this on unless you have a specific reason to disable it.

Building your ideal configuration

Here are some example configurations for different trading styles:

  • Long-term fundamental investor: Confidence 60%+, mute Launch and Momentum, keep Sentinel and Nexus active.
  • New token trader: Confidence 40%+, keep Launch and Scam active, mute Narrative.
  • Whale follower: Confidence 70%+, keep only Whale and Alert tags, disable Hunter and Nexus.
  • Full coverage: 0% confidence, all tags active โ€” the default. Best if you want a comprehensive view and do your own filtering.
